基于AMS反向追踪的二维门限重构算法

摘    要:提出了基于AMS(Advanced Marking Schemes)的二维门限重构算法.该算法在重构过程中设置了二维门限mf,d,通过判断攻击包的边域和节点的Hash值匹配情况,快速而准确地重构出攻击路径,从而缩短了整体重构时间和业务开销,并使准确度和稳定性得以提高,与传统方法相比,该二维门限重构算法使得反向追踪性能明显改善.

AMS based reconstruction algorithm with the two-dimentional threshold for IP traceback

Abstract:We present a new reconstruction algorithm based on the Advanced Marking Scheme(AMS).It works with a two-dimentional threshold m_(f,d),decides if a node is on the attack path by judging the situation of the edge of the packet and the Hash value match,then consequently reduces the time of reconstruction and overhead and improves accuracy and stability.Compared with the conventional methods,two-dimentional threshold reconstruction algorithm impves the performance of the IP traceback technique obviously.
